3 Cl2 + 6 OH- ClO3- + 5 (Cl)- + 3 H2O

This is an oxidation-reduction (redox) reaction:

5 Cl0 + 5 e- 5 Cl-I (reduction)

Cl0 - 5 e- ClV (oxidation)

Cl2 is both an oxidizing and a reducing agent (disproportionation (dismutation)).
